#1baa2c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1baa2c is composed of 10.6% red, 66.7%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.1%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 127.1 degrees, a saturation of 72.6% and a lightness of 38.6%. #1baa2c color hex could be obtained by blending #36ff58 with #005500.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#1baa2c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1baa2c has RGB values of R:27, G:170,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 1813036.

Shades and Tints of #1baa2c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#effcf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1baa2c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6660 is the less saturated color, while #04c11b is the most saturated one.
